Becca Bell killed Pip’s dog Barney in A Good Girl’s Guide To Murder

Andie’s sister wanted Pip to stop the investigation

Carla Woodcock as Becca Bell in


Andie’s sister, Becca Bell, is the one who kills her in A Good Girl’s Guide to Murder – And She is also the reason why Barney dies in today’s story.y. Becca seems to be a minor character in much of the Netflix series, but her role in Andie’s death is more significant than the series initially suggests. Becca obviously wants Pip to stop her investigation, so she takes Barney and blackmails Pip using her influence.

Since Barney is found dead after Becca stole him, It can be assumed that she is the one who kills Pip’s dog in the Netflix seriesHowever, this is never shown in the series – and in Holly Jackson’s book, things are more complicated. Becca still kidnaps Barney in the original, but she claims that she didn’t really mean to kill him. Barney falls into a river in the novel after Becca lets him go. This is one of the changes A Good Girl’s Guide to Murder makes to the book. However, in both versions of the story, Barney dies because of Becca’s actions.


Why Becca killed Barney and how she secretly kidnapped him

Pip’s social media post sent Becca into a panic

Becca kidnaps Barney so that Pip will stop her investigation because she doesn’t want to be exposed as Andie’s real murderer. Killing Barney seems like an extreme step, but Pip doesn’t heed any of Becca’s previous warnings. And Pip’s social media post about Andie sends Becca into a panicwhich leads her to pursue someone Pip loves. Becca’s actions also almost have the desired effect. Pip briefly considers dropping the investigation at Ravi’s request. Fortunately, she does not do so, as at the end of A guide to murder for good girls.

How Becca got Barney remains to be seen. The show doesn’t show her kidnapping the dog, but Barney disappears during Pip’s brother’s birthday party. It seems Becca uses this distraction to act. During the celebrations, Pip doesn’t notice that Barney is missing, so Becca’s plan works. A Good Girl’s Guide to Murder makes Pip confront this tragedy and forces her to take the threats she faces a little more seriously.
